|  | // <string> | 
|  |  | 
|  | // const charT& back() const; // constexpr since C++20 | 
|  | //       charT& back(); // constexpr since C++20 | 
|  |  | 
|  | #include <string> | 
|  | #include <cassert> | 
|  |  | 
|  | #include "test_macros.h" | 
|  | #include "min_allocator.h" | 
|  |  | 
|  | template <class S> | 
|  | TEST_CONSTEXPR_CXX20 void | 
|  | test(S s) | 
|  | { | 
|  | const S& cs = s; | 
|  | ASSERT_SAME_TYPE(decltype( s.back()), typename S::reference); | 
|  | ASSERT_SAME_TYPE(decltype(cs.back()), typename S::const_reference); | 
|  | LIBCPP_ASSERT_NOEXCEPT(    s.back()); | 
|  | LIBCPP_ASSERT_NOEXCEPT(   cs.back()); | 
|  | assert(&cs.back() == &cs[cs.size()-1]); | 
|  | assert(&s.back() == &s[cs.size()-1]); | 
|  | s.back() = typename S::value_type('z'); | 
|  | assert(s.back() == typename S::value_type('z')); | 
|  | } | 
|  |  | 
|  | TEST_CONSTEXPR_CXX20 bool test() { | 
|  | { | 
|  | typedef std::string S; | 
|  | test(S("1")); | 
|  | test(S("1234567890123456789012345678901234567890")); | 
|  | } | 
|  | #if TEST_STD_VER >= 11 | 
|  | { | 
|  | typedef std::basic_string<char, std::char_traits<char>, min_allocator<char>> S; | 
|  | test(S("1")); | 
|  | test(S("1234567890123456789012345678901234567890")); | 
|  | } | 
|  | #endif | 
|  |  | 
|  | return true; | 
|  | } | 
|  |  | 
|  | int main(int, char**) | 
|  | { | 
|  | test(); | 
|  | #if TEST_STD_VER > 17 | 
|  | static_assert(test()); | 
|  | #endif | 
|  |  | 
|  | return 0; | 
|  | } |
